The Division of Library Development offers directed LSTA grants that provide up to $5,000 (with 25% local match requirement) to libraries to provide or enhance services and collections* to older adults. Projects bring library programs, materials, and/or services to older adults who have difficulty accessing traditional library services or extend lifelong learning programs to older adults. Attending one informational grant-writing session is required in order for a library to submit an application.
